TE Connectivity / Holsworthy RN73 High Precision Resistors

TE Connectivity / Holsworthy RN73 High Precision Resistors are stable precision chip resistors offering a range of various power dissipation relating to chip size, TCRs down to 5ppm/°C and 10ppm/°C, and resistor tolerances to 0.1%. The components are produced with three sputtered layers to offer better performance. The RN73 resistors feature values restricted to the E96 grid and have accurate and uniform physical dimensions to facilitate placement. Ideal application includes communications, industrial controls, instrumentation, and medical.

Features

  • High precision, TCR 5ppm/°C and 10ppm/°C
  • Tolerance down to 0.01%
  • Thin film (nichrome)
  • Terminal finish: electroplated 100% matte Sn

Applications

  • Communications
  • Industrial controls
  • Instrumentation
  • Medical
